Robert Townsend CONFIRMS ‘Five Heartbeats’ Sequel
Actor/writer/director Robert Townsend is developing a sequel to his 1991 film “The Five Heartbeats”, says BlackAmericaWeb.
“I am working on a sequel. Next year I’ll be making an announcement”, Townsend said on the Tom Joyner Morning Show, according to the site.

The film tells of an all-male group, struggling to make it as big-time musicians whilst battling their own demons, and aside from Townsend, featured early performances from “Man of Steel” actor Harry J.Lennix and Leon (“Cool Runnings”).

Nakamichi was founded in 1948 by Mr. Etsuro Nakamichi, and has since established itself as a trusted creator of high-quality audio products that deliver sound, style, and substance. The Nakamichi product line is driven by an intense scientific curiosity, the love of music, and commitment to uncompromising quality and performance.

Nakamichi was born from a small research institute in Tokyo, Japan that provided R&D for major brands, government entities, universities, and organizations in the private sector. The first Nakamichi product was a reel-to-reel cassette deck, the Nakamichi 1000, which quickly set the standard for top-of-the-line cassette decks. Since then, Nakamichi has contributed to various innovations in technology, such as the compact disc and similar optical memory systems, paving the way for an entire range of high-end consumer electronics.
Today, Nakamichi prides itself on relentless research and development, while delivering some of the world's best products to people who appreciate sound at its highest quality.

Solange Falls Out With Her ‘True’ Producer Over Twitter
Just months after Danity Kane’s Dawn Richard and her “Goldenheart’ producer Drew Scott parted ways as musical partners and friends, another musical duo has chuck deuces to each other. Solange Knowles and her ‘True” EP producing partner Dev Hynes [aka Blood Orange] are on the outs, and they recently spilled their beef on to Twitter.  This week, Dev hinted that there was trouble in paradise when he posted the subliminal tweets:

If you wanna take shots at me text me call me talk to me in person but don’t ever drop a subliminal, talk behind my back, or send a flunky. I’m doing myself. Ain’t nothing to do with anyone else, I’m about myself, like any self respecting human should be. We live & die alone. I have beef with no one. I won’t even mention your name ever again. Any of you. I’ve said my bit. I’ve reached out. I’ve praised you. But now it’s done. It’s over. We’re done. Bye.
To which Solange responded:
When you do Tumblr posts, speak about things in interviews, tweet, issues then belong to the public. I have been minding my biz. I have only ever praised you and spoken about you positively, even when our perspectives were totally different. I still support your artistry & am extremely happy for your success. I just wished you were honest about the making of my album. That’s all I’m going to say on this. You know more than anyone n—as love drama. Also u know very well I have reached out. Bless. Ps: Your phone been going straight to VM for long time.

The actual fallout seems to have happened earlier this year and stemmed from a few articles posted on Solange’s music, which praised and credited Dev Hynes for her sound. According to a Fader article posted just last week:

In April, though, some public tension emerged concerning who wrote what on Hynes’ most successful collaborations. Solange, seemingly dissatisfied with the way Hynes’ role was being described in reviews, sent off a string of tweets about True to her one million followers: “Y’all got it all the way wrong. Ive been writing and producing my own voice since 02, nigga … I find it very disappointing when I am presented as the ‘face’ of my music, or a ‘vocal muse’ when I write or co-write every f-cking song … Sexism in the industry ain’t nothing new.” I ask Hynes if he believes her tweets were in response to something he had said. “I didn’t say anything,” Hynes says. “She reads reviews. I’ve never read a single Blood Orange review in my life.”

Though Solange declined to comment for this story, her use of “vocal muse” seemed to refer to a Pitchfork review of True that employed the phrase. The exact circumstances surrounding their falling out are unclear—and the two still share a manager. Hynes says they never resolved the issue. “We’ve spoken but I don’t know where it’s at,” he says. Hynes says he wrote a good portion of the album entirely himself, especially the songs “Losing You” and “Bad Girls,” which he wrote and recorded versions of before he even knew Solange, with Solange adding mostly structural and vocal changes throughout. But it’s difficult to quantify exactly who contributed what. Within a couple of months, though, Hynes had quit the tour before it was over and returned to New York, and he wasn’t asked to work with Solange on her next album.
At a show in a Chinatown boutique in September, an overpacked crowd turns up to see a rare Blood Orange performance with a full band. Hynes, in a long coat and leather kufi, takes off his jacket to perform “Bad Girls,” one of the songs he wrote that Solange re-recorded for True. Then, before launching into “Everything Is Embarrassing,” Hynes gives a brief monologue, oddly compelled to footnote a song he created: “I’ve got a lot of shots ready to be fired, and I guess this is the shot. This is a song I wrote for another singer. She said a couple weeks ago that she doesn’t like when I say I wrote it—this happens a lot to me, but I’m not an arrogant guy. That said, I’ve written some songs for people and they haven’t given me due credit and it pisses me off.

Wu-Tang Clan Affiliate Killa Sin Charged With Attempted Murder In Staten Island
It's a sad day for Wu-Tang Clan fans and even bleaker one for Jeryl Grant, b.k.a. as Killa Sin of the group Killarmy. This past Saturday of November 23, he was arrested on charges of second-degree attempted murder and second-degree criminal possession of a weapon for allegedly shooting a man six times in the chest.

Reports: SILive
The shooting took place down the block from the Sangita Shala night club at 556 Richmond Road about 4 a.m. Saturday, authorities said, and left a man -- identified by sources as Darnell Brown, 33 -- wounded, though not fatally. That club saw a gun-related incident back in February, according to police.
Police arrested the alleged shooter, Jeryl Grant, 37, of the 100 block of St. Mark's Place in St. George, Wednesday. He's charged with second-degree attempted murder and second-degree criminal possession of a weapon, according to information from District Attorney Daniel Donovan's office.
Grant gave detectives an account of what happened, according to a law enforcement source: He said he parked his truck behind the night club, which he referred to as "Fires," then headed to a birthday party at Edgewater Hall on Bay Street in Stapleton.
Grant got a ride back to his truck sometime between 3 and 3:30 a.m., and found people hanging around it. "And next thing you know there's a shooting. At least that's what he told investigators," the source said.
Even if the plea of self-defense is heard out in court, there's a few disclaimers that could speak inevitable doom for Grant. He's currently on parole until Oct. 3, 2015 for criminal weapons possession. Killa Sin served two stints in prison for the same charge-- a three-year sentence for in 2003, and a four-year sentence for a 2007.

Lacefront Wig Wearer’s Rejoice: Sony Creating A SmartWig
Sony has filed a patent for a SmartWig. Yep you read that right. The application describes a standard wig that could “be made from horse hair, human hair, wool, feathers, yak hair or any kind of synthetic material,” with a circuit board hidden among those luscious locks.  I guess you will be able to have your U part give you GPS directions?
Their smartwatch is already in its second generation and has been on the market since 2012. So perhaps they are getting bored for the expected and are really thinking out-of-the-box. But this is really out there (even for me).

According to the patent filing the wig is meant to cover at least part of the user’s head with at least one sensor for input, a communication interface and the necessary processors to handle these. All of these components are meant to be hidden in the wig.
The filing goes on to detail that the SmartWig would have GPS, an integrated camera and the ability to transmit and receive ultrasound waves. It would also be able to talk to a secondary computer (like a smartphone or tablet or even another wearable with a screen) and provide tactile feedback to the wearer.
